Read moreSmall "museum" with information about the local product. The entrance is free if you want to see the process of making the cheese only. We did taste the cheeses for a small price and it's very good. The information is present scanning QR-codes with really well spoken English and German audio. People are friendly and you can also buy the local product after the visit. Outside there is a viewpoint at about 960m which we didn't visit as it rained.
